    French Mill Rise is a residential street in SP7, SHAFTESBURY, with 5 properties recorded in the Land Registry. The 3-year average sale price is £527,500, based on 2 transactions. The street ranks 49th of 212 streets in SP7 by average price.

    District Context — SP7

    SP7 covers the Dorset area around Shaftesbury and the surrounding rural villages and market towns in the north of the county. It is a predominantly rural district with a character shaped by historic market towns, countryside, and a relatively mature residential population.
